[ros-diffs] [tkreuzer] 37507: Fix definitions of PFN_COUNT and (S)PFN_NUMBER

tkreuzer at svn.reactos.org tkreuzer at svn.reactos.org
Fri Nov 21 12:32:37 CET 2008


Author: tkreuzer
Date: Fri Nov 21 05:32:37 2008
New Revision: 37507

URL: http://svn.reactos.org/svn/reactos?rev=37507&view=rev
Log:
Fix definitions of PFN_COUNT and (S)PFN_NUMBER

Modified:
    branches/ros-amd64-bringup/reactos/include/ddk/winddk.h

Modified: branches/ros-amd64-bringup/reactos/include/ddk/winddk.h
URL: http://svn.reactos.org/svn/reactos/branches/ros-amd64-bringup/reactos/include/ddk/winddk.h?rev=37507&r1=37506&r2=37507&view=diff
==============================================================================
--- branches/ros-amd64-bringup/reactos/include/ddk/winddk.h [iso-8859-1] (original)
+++ branches/ros-amd64-bringup/reactos/include/ddk/winddk.h [iso-8859-1] Fri Nov 21 05:32:37 2008
@@ -4926,11 +4926,6 @@
   IoModifyAccess
 } LOCK_OPERATION;
 
-typedef ULONG PFN_COUNT;
-
-typedef LONG SPFN_NUMBER, *PSPFN_NUMBER;
-typedef ULONG PFN_NUMBER, *PPFN_NUMBER;
-
 #define FLUSH_MULTIPLE_MAXIMUM 32
 
 typedef enum _MM_SYSTEM_SIZE {
@@ -5423,6 +5418,8 @@
 
 #ifdef _X86_
 
+typedef ULONG PFN_COUNT;
+typedef LONG SPFN_NUMBER, *PSPFN_NUMBER;
 typedef ULONG PFN_NUMBER, *PPFN_NUMBER;
 
 #define PASSIVE_LEVEL                      0
@@ -5527,6 +5524,10 @@
 #define KI_USER_SHARED_DATA               0xffdf0000
 
 #elif defined(__x86_64__)
+
+typedef ULONG PFN_COUNT;
+typedef LONG64 SPFN_NUMBER, *PSPFN_NUMBER;
+typedef ULONG64 PFN_NUMBER, *PPFN_NUMBER;
 
 #define PASSIVE_LEVEL                      0
 #define LOW_LEVEL                          0
@@ -5641,6 +5642,8 @@
 
 #elif defined(__PowerPC__)
 
+typedef ULONG PFN_COUNT;
+typedef LONG SPFN_NUMBER, *PSPFN_NUMBER;
 typedef ULONG PFN_NUMBER, *PPFN_NUMBER;
 
 #define PASSIVE_LEVEL                      0
@@ -5714,6 +5717,8 @@
 
 #error MIPS Headers are totally incorrect
 
+typedef ULONG PFN_COUNT;
+typedef LONG SPFN_NUMBER, *PSPFN_NUMBER;
 typedef ULONG PFN_NUMBER, *PPFN_NUMBER;
 
 #define PASSIVE_LEVEL                      0



More information about the Ros-diffs mailing list